Output 51f8fa8bf6a0fdac32e8912c12c031cd30ed8be397694e833509ad932a1d6f33:0

value
95501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03147d995aa3b5366fe4597d2cdcef82fc76caf OP_EQUAL
address
3GJ35KMDhRaisTAyJYcR5vV6R12SqaKfUx
transaction
51f8fa8bf6a0fdac32e8912c12c031cd30ed8be397694e833509ad932a1d6f33
confirmations
140882
spent
true